Abstract

The invention discloses an upward arraying and hanging automatic door which is capable of improving the door panel movement smoothness and the transmission efficiency. The upward arraying and hanging automatic door comprise a pair of door frame rails which are in an opening relative state, a controller and a door panel, wherein the controller is arranged on the upper ends of the pair of door frame rails; a transmission motor and two groups of transmission mechanisms which are connected with and driven by the transmission motor are arranged inside the controller; the two groups of transmission mechanisms are respectively arranged on the top ends of the door frame rails on two sides; each group of transmission mechanisms comprises a first transmission group which is connected with and driven by the transmission motor, a second transmission group which is connected with and driven by the first transmission group, a third transmission group which is connected with and driven by the second transmission group, a support frame which extends from the front end to the rear end and gradually inclines and drops, and a lower rail which is located at a proper position below the support frame, extends from the front end to the rear end, and gradually inclines and drops, wherein the third transmission group is provided with a chain which extends towards the door frame rails; a guide block with a longitudinal elongated slot is arranged at the side edge of the third transmission group in a pivoting way, and is inserted and fixed to the third transmission group by a bolt penetrating the elongated slot; a pair of poking rods forming a downward groove is arranged on the bottom of a block body of the guide block in an extending way; an inlet of the lower rail just corresponds to the top ends of the door frame rails.
